WordPress非插件使用Prism.js实现代码高亮
发布时间:2020-12-14 14:32:46 所属栏目:wordpress 来源:网络整理
导读:对于技术控的朋友来说,平日总要写几段代码来装装逼。 市面上也比较多代码高亮插件,各种各样。前端时间苏醒网站改版也没集成代码高亮的功能。 今天有点时间就研究了下,发现Prism.js这个轻量级的JavaScript代码高亮很好耍! Prism.JS也大部分流行的编程语言
对于技术控的朋友来说,平日总要写几段代码来装装逼。 市面上也比较多代码高亮插件,各种各样。前端时间苏醒网站改版也没集成代码高亮的功能。 今天有点时间就研究了下,发现Prism.js这个轻量级的JavaScript代码高亮很好耍! Prism.JS也大部分流行的编程语言,并且支持多种主题样式,只需要引用CSS文件和JS文件即可完成。 好东西要分享,果断分享给大家。 第一步:将下面的代码复制到funcations.php中 function add_prism() { wp_register_style( 'prismCSS', get_stylesheet_directory_uri() . '/prism.css' //自定义路径 ); wp_register_script( 'prismJS', get_stylesheet_directory_uri() . '/prism.js' //自定义路径 ); wp_enqueue_style('prismCSS'); wp_enqueue_script('prismJS'); } add_action('wp_enqueue_scripts', 'add_prism'); 以上工作结束后,就可以实现代码高亮了。 对,就这么简单。 第二步:编辑文章时,使用文本模式,输入下面的代码。 <pre class="language-c"><code class="language-c"> code_here </code></pre> language-c可修改任意语言,但必须保留language-,如language-php 使用技巧如果你想每行代码前带序号,只需要在<pre>标签中加class=”line-numbers” 即可。 Prism.js文件下载地址:http://prismjs.com/ (编辑:李大同)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|